To my surprise last week I noticed that I can get into update mode on the same record from two different sessions at the same time.
This only happens in my Windows 7 Pro 64 bit system running filePro 5.0.11.
I start up two different filePro sessions on my Windows monitor, and they can update the same record at the same time.
I make a change in one and save it, then save the other and it wipes out the change made by the first.
On my SCO Unix 5 system, trying to do this results in a message that says the record is being updated, access denied.
It should work that way in Windows too.
I also found that if I am in update mode on a record and run an output process from another session, that process will update the record I am on even while I am in update mode.  On my Unix system, the output process will wait for the record to be unlocked.
So it appears that record locking does not work on my Windows system, and I am wondering if anybody else has this problem or if anyone has an idea of how or why it could happen?
